Customs Spokesperson Maiwada Makes 2025 PR Power List

The National Public Relations Officer of the Nigeria Customs Service (NCS), Assistant Comptroller of Customs Abdullahi Maiwada, has been named among Nigeria’s top 50 public relations and communications professionals in the 2025 PR Power List.

The list, published by GLG Communications in partnership with The Guardian Newspaper on Wednesday, July 16, 2025, recognises excellence and innovation in the field of public relations.

The PR Power List is an annual ranking that honours professionals who have shaped narratives and driven impactful change within the communication landscape, both in Nigeria and across the diaspora.

AC Maiwada was featured in the Changemakers category, which celebrates professionals who actively challenge the norms and introduce innovative communication strategies with measurable results.

Reacting to the recognition, Maiwada described it as a humbling milestone and a testament to the progress made in institutional communication within the NCS.

“This recognition is deeply humbling. It speaks to the commitment of the Service to modernise public engagement, enhance transparency, and build trust through effective storytelling and timely dissemination of accurate information.

“While I am honoured to be listed, I believe the greater credit goes to the team I work with and the visionary leadership of the Comptroller-General of Customs, Bashir Adewale Adeniyi, whose reforms have empowered us to think differently, act boldly, and represent the Service with dignity and professionalism,” he stated.

The Power List, signed by Oreani Ogbe, Managing Partner at GLG Communications, categorises honourees into four distinct groups: Rising Voices, Community Impact, Changemakers, and Fourth Estate. Each category highlights a different dimension of influence, ranging from innovative storytelling and ethical communication standards to media power and strategic leadership.

The 2025 edition specifically commended individuals like AC Maiwada for “shaping the future of public relations through bold moves, long-term experience, and impact-driven communication.”
